Are you still relying on email to accept resumes and job applications? If so, you‘re missing out on a major opportunity to improve your hiring process.
Consider this:
- 60% of job seekers say they have quit an online application due to its length or complexity (Source: CareerBuilder)
- Companies with an efficient job application process improve the quality of their hires by 70% (Source: Glassdoor)
- Applicants are 38% more likely to accept a job offer if they are satisfied with the hiring process (Source: IBM)
The takeaway is clear: optimizing your job application process directly impacts the quantity and quality of applicants you attract – and your ability to hire top talent.
One of the easiest ways to streamline job applications is to add an online form to your WordPress site. A dedicated job application form makes it simple for candidates to submit their information and attachments, while also making it easier for your hiring team to collect and manage applications.
In this guide, we‘ll show you exactly how to create a professional job application form in WordPress, step-by-step. No coding or technical skills required!
Why Use a Job Application Form in WordPress?
There are many reasons to use an online job application form in WordPress instead of relying on email applications:
Better for applicants:
- Provides a seamless, professional application experience
- Applicants can easily apply from any device (desktop, mobile, tablet)
- Customizable forms let you collect all the info you need
- Faster than manually writing an application email
Better for hiring teams:
- All applications are collected in a single, centralized database
- No more sorting through cluttered email inboxes
- Automatically parse and search applicant information
- Easily rating, comment, and change status of applications
- Integrate with your ATS, HR, and CRM software
Better for your brand:
- Reinforces a professional, tech-savvy employer brand
- Reflects your company culture and values
- Positive candidate experience = higher offer acceptance rates
The bottom line is that an online job application form saves time for both candidates and recruiters, while providing a better overall experience.
How to Create a Job Application Form in WordPress
Ready to create your own job application form? Follow these steps:
Step 1: Install WPForms on Your WordPress Site
First, you‘ll need a WordPress form builder plugin. We recommend WPForms, the most beginner-friendly form plugin for WordPress.
To get started, install and activate the WPForms plugin on your WordPress site. You‘ll find the download in your WPForms account under the Downloads tab.
Step 2: Choose the Job Application Form Template
Once WPForms is installed, go to WPForms > Add New and name your form. Then, scroll down to the pre-built Job Application Form template.

This template includes the following fields:
- Name
- Phone
- Current Company
- Cover Letter
- Resume Upload
- Referral Source
- GDPR Agreement
It‘s a great starting point, but of course you can fully customize the form to fit your exact hiring needs. In the next step, we‘ll show you how to easily edit the template using the drag-and-drop builder.
Step 3: Customize Your Form Fields
Now you‘re in the WPForms editor, where you can visually build and edit your job application form:

Here‘s how to customize your form fields:
Add Fields
To add a new field, simply drag it from the left-hand panel to the form preview on the right.
Some extra fields you may want to add to your job application form include:
- LinkedIn profile or portfolio URL
- Desired salary range
- Work authorization status
- Start date
- Custom questions related to the role
Edit Fields
To edit an existing field, just click on it in the form preview. This will open the Field Options panel where you can:
- Change the label
- Add a description
- Mark fields as required
- Customize the choices (for dropdowns, checkboxes, etc.)
- Set maximum file upload size
- Enable conditional logic
Delete Fields
To remove a field, hover over it and click the red trash icon.
Rearrange Fields
To change the order of fields, drag and drop them into place in the preview panel.
For example, you may want to rearrange the fields in this order for an improved applicant experience:
- Name
- Phone
- LinkedIn URL
- Current Company
- Resume Upload
- Cover Letter
- Referral Source
- GDPR Agreement
Make sure to click Save after customizing your form.
Step 4: Customize the Form Settings
Next, go to Settings > General to configure the key form settings:
- Submit Button Text – Customize the label (e.g. "Apply Now")
- Submissions – Enable the anti-spam honeypot to prevent spam applications
- AJAX Forms – Enable AJAX to submit forms without refreshing the page
Under Settings > Notifications, customize the email notifications that will be sent when a new job application is submitted:
- Send To Email Address – Enter the email address(es) of the hiring manager or HR team member who should be notified about new applications
- Email Subject Line – Customize the email subject (e.g. "New Job Application Submission")
- From Name – Set the name emails will come from (e.g. "Acme HR")
- From Email – Set the email address for the "From" header (this should be an address at your company‘s domain)
- Reply-To – Check the box to set the reply-to email as the applicant‘s address
In the Email Message box, customize the email that will be sent when a new application comes in. For example:
Subject: New job application from {field_name}
A new job application was submitted:
Name: {field_name}
Email: {field_email}
Phone: {field_phone}
Resume: {field_resume}
You can view the full application details in WordPress under WPForms > Entries.Under Settings > Confirmations, customize the message applicants will see after submitting their application. For example:
Thanks {field_name}!
Your application for {field_position} has been received. Our HR team will review your qualifications and contact you if they feel you may be a good fit for this position.
In the meantime, feel free to browse our [company blog](https://example.com/blog/) to learn more about our culture and current projects.
We appreciate your interest in joining the ACME team!Save your form settings and move on to the next step.
Step 5: Add Your Job Application Form to Your Site
Finally, it‘s time to publish your job application form.
We recommend creating a dedicated Careers page on your site to house your form, along with information about:
- Your company mission, culture, and values
- Employee benefits and perks
- Diversity and inclusion initiatives
- Career development opportunities
To create a new page for your form, go to Pages > Add New and give it a descriptive title (e.g. "Careers at ACME").
Then, click the + button to add the WPForms block and select your job application form from the dropdown:

Alternatively, you can embed the form using the provided shortcode:
[wpforms id="123"]Publish your careers page, then apply for a job on the frontend of your site to test the form and notification settings.
Bonus Tips: How to Optimize Your WordPress Job Application Form
Follow these best practices to make your job application form as effective as possible:
Keep it short and focused
Respect candidates‘ time by only asking for the information you absolutely need to evaluate their qualifications at this initial stage. A study by Indeed found that application completion rates drop off significantly if it takes longer than 15 minutes to complete.
Write clear instructions
Include a brief explanation of your hiring process and what applicants can expect after submitting their information. Providing a timeline for follow ups can reduce candidate frustration and boost application completion rates.
Optimize for mobile
Over 60% of job seekers now look for jobs and submit applications on their smartphones. Luckily, WPForms is fully responsive out of the box, so your form will automatically adapt to any screen size. Just make sure to preview and test it for usability.
Use conditional logic
WPForms‘ Smart Logic feature lets you show or hide fields based on the applicant‘s previous answers. For example, you could show an "Upload Portfolio" field only to applicants who select "Graphic Designer" as the position they‘re applying for.
Integrate with your other tools
Streamline your hiring workflow by connecting your WordPress job application form to your other recruiting tools. WPForms integrates with popular solutions like:
- Uncanny Automator for no-code workflow automation
- Zapier and Tray.io for connecting to 1000+ apps
- HubSpot for syncing form data to your CRM
- Trello for organizing candidates in a kanban board
- Slack for instant notifications about new applicants
Customize your confirmation and autoresponder
Make a great impression by crafting a branded, stand-out submission confirmation and autoresponder email. This is a chance to reaffirm your employer brand, set expectations around next steps, and get applicants excited about the opportunity.
Test and iterate
As with any recruiting strategy, it‘s important to measure results and look for opportunities to optimize. Keep an eye on key metrics like views to submission rate, abandonment rate, and of course, quality of applicants. Don‘t be afraid to experiment with your form design, length, questions, etc. to see what works best.
Create Your WordPress Job Application Form Today
Adding an online job application form to your WordPress site is one of the simplest ways to improve your recruiting process. With a 1-click template and drag-and-drop builder, WPForms makes it easy to start accepting applications in minutes – no coding required.
Remember, every interaction a candidate has with your company is part of their overall experience. Implementing a user-friendly, professional job application process will help you attract more qualified applicants, and ultimately make better hires.
So what are you waiting for? Get started with the WPForms Job Application Form template today!
